Use care when mounting all components.
Use only rosin core solder (acid core solder is never used
in electronics work. ) A proper solder joint has just enough solder to cover the I.ound soldering pad
and about 1/16 inch of the lead passing through it.
There are two improper comections to beware of:
Using too little solder will sometimes result in a connection which appears to be soldered but actually
there is a layer of flux insulating the component lead from the solder bead.
This situation can be
cured by re-heating the joint and applying more solder.
If too much solder is used there is the danger
that a conducting bridge of excess solder will flow between adjacent circuit board conductors forming
a short circuit.
Unintentional solder bridges can be cleaned off by holding the board up-side down and
flowing the excess solder off onto a clean hot soldering iron.
Select a soldering iron with a small tip and a power rating not more than 35 watts.
Soldering guns are
completely unacceptable for assembling transistorized equipment because the large magnetic field they
generate can damage solid state components.

Up to this point all components have been ron-polarized and either lead could be placed in either of
the holes provided without affecting the operation of the circuit.
Electrolytic capacitors are polarized
and most be mounted so that the ''+ " lead of the capacitor goes through the ''+ " hole in the circuit
board.
In the event that the ''-'' lead of the capacitor is marked rather than the " + " lead it is to go
throngh the unmarked hole in the circuit board.
Note that the operating voltage (v. ) specified for a capacitor is the minimum acceptable rating.
Capacitors supplied with specffic kits may have a higher voltage rating than that specified and may
be used despite this difference.
For instance. a 100 mid. 25v. capacitor may be used in place of
a 100 mid. 10v. capacitor without affecting the operation Of the circuit.

hstall the transistors.
Orientation Of the transistors is keyed by the flat on the side of the case and
should be evident from inspection of the parts placement diagram shown in figure 1 and the parts
placement designators printed on the circuit board. All semi-conductors are heat sensitive and may
be damaged if allowed to get too hot during soldering.
To be on the safe side heat sink each transistor
lead during the soldering operation by grasping it with a pair of needle-nosed pliers at a point between
the circuit board and the body of the transistor.
